Stephen Harper to join law firm in Calgary

Former prime minister Stephen Harper, who resigned his seat in Parliament to pursue a new career in international business consulting, is set to join Dentons LLP’s Calgary office, sources say.The massive global law firm, which counts former Liberal prime minister Jean Chrétien as one of its most prominent lawyers, has offices across Canada and around the world – including Shanghai, London and Washington. Mr. Harper’s work at Dentons will dovetail with his newly established international business consulting practice.
